Emperors are male rulers of empires, often with the highest authority over a collection of countries or territories. The term is most often used in historical contexts.
Uso & Matices
Mostly used for historical rulers (e.g., Roman, Chinese, Japanese emperors). The female version is 'empress.' Not commonly used for modern leaders. 'Emperor' emphasizes higher power than 'king.'
